WebOption #1: Withdraw from the Class. Withdrawing is not the same thing as dropping a class early in the semester. When a student drops a class, it disappears from their schedule. After the “drop/add” period, a student may still have the option to withdraw. Withdrawal usually means the course remains on the transcript with a “W” as a grade. Web26 de fev. de 2024 · There is a 90-day waiting period to retake a CLEP exam. But this only applies to retakes on the exact same exam. So, for example, if you take and fail your English Composition exam, you can still take an Introductory to Psychology CLEP exam the next day.
